Overview
Denmark, officially the Kingdom of Denmark, is a Nordic country in Northern Europe. It consists of the Jutland Peninsula and an archipelago of more than 400 islands, with Zealand, Funen, and Lolland being the largest.
With a population of around 5.8 million, Denmark is famous for its high standard of living, progressive social policies, and innovative design. The country consistently ranks among the world's happiest nations.
Denmark is a member of the European Union, NATO, and other major international organizations. Its capital, Copenhagen, is a vibrant city known for its cycling culture, excellent restaurants, and beautiful architecture.
